Old Fashioned Sugar Cookies
5 cups flour, sifted
1 cup butter
1 cup confectioners sugar
1 cup sugar
1 cup vegetable oil
2 eggs
2 teaspoon vanilla
1 teaspoon baking soda
1 teaspoon cream of tartar
Cream sugar and margarine. Than add oil, vanilla and sugar in that order. Mix and add eggs. Put in sifted flour, soda, salt and cream of tartar. Mix well. Shape in balls or use cookie cutters to make shapes. Dip in sugar and cook for 350 degrees Fahrenheit for 10 minutes.
Cream Cheese Cookies
8 oz cream cheese
2 sticks butter
2 cups flour, sifted
2 cups sugar
1 teaspoon vanilla
1 cup chopped walnuts, if desired
Cream together cream cheese and butter. Add sugar, vanilla and cream. Add flour slowly. Mix well and add walnuts. Mix again.
Drop by teaspoon on ungreased cookie sheet. Bake at 350 degrees Fahrenheit for 10 to 12 minutes. Let sit for one minutes and remove.
Molasses Oatmeal Cookies
1 ¼ cup flour, sifted
¾ teaspoon baking soda
½ teaspoon baking powder
½ teaspoon salt
1 teaspoon ginger
1 teaspoon cinnamon
½ cup shortening
½ cup sugar
½ cup molasses
1 ½ cup oats, uncooked
1 cup chopped walnuts
Sift flour, baking soda, baking powder, salt and spices into mixing bowl. Add remaining ingredients and mix well.
Place tablespoon for big cookies and teaspoon for smaller cookies at a time on ungreased baking sheet and cook for 15 minutes at 350 degrees Fahrenheit.
Chocolate Lovers Cookies
½ lbs sweet cooking chocolate
1 tablespoon butter
2 eggs
2/3 cup sugar
¼ cup flour, sifted
Salt, pinch
1 teaspoon vanilla
½ cups walnuts
Melt chocolate and butter together. Beat eggs until foamy and then add sugar and beat. Blend in chocolate. Add dry ingredients and mix. Stir in vanilla and nuts. Drop by teaspoon on ungreased cookie sheet. Back 12 to 15 minutes at 350 degrees Fahrenheit.
Cool and serve.

Butter Cookies
1 cup butter
2/2 cup sugar
1 egg
1 teaspoon vanilla
2 cups flour
1/8 teaspoon salt
¼ cup sprinkles
Cream butter and sugar. Add egg. Then add other ingredients. Mix well. I usually put in cookie press. Then sprinkle sprinkles. Cook 6 minutes at 400 degrees Fahrenheit.
M&M Cookies
1 cup shortening
1 cup brown sugar
½ cup granulated sugar
2 teaspoons vanilla
2 eggs
2 cups flour
1 teaspoon baking soda
1 teaspoon salt
1 ½ cups M&Ms
Mix shortening and sugar. Then add vanilla and eggs. Sift flour, salt and baking soda and add into mixture. Add all other ingredients and ½ of M&M's. Mix well and put on ungreased cookie sheet by teaspoon. Mix in remainder of M&Ms. Bake at 375 degrees Fahrenheit for 10-12 minutes.
